Description

Flower shape: Clusters of yellow tubular flowers resembling small firecrackers provide reliable color from spring through fall.
Slender, rush-like stems start out erect, then fall over into long, showy cascades.
A favorite of hummingbirds; this perennial is a must-have for tropical butterfly gardens.
Great for a tall border, trained to a trellis, or spilling over walls and hanging baskets.
Sunlight: Full Sun / Partial Shade
Amount of Water: Water regularly, when the top 3 in. of soil is dry.
Soil Conditions: Well-drained
Cold Hardiness Zone: 9-11
Provide rich, well-drained soil in full sun.
Best with part shade in hot inland areas.
Follow a regular watering schedule during the first growing season to establish a deep, extensive root system. Fertilize regularly.
Prune in late winter or early spring.
